The ingredients needed to make Ndizi ya kisii (banana stew):
- Get 5 nice thick medium sized raw bananas - ukipata ya kisii au meru the better π
- Get 1 large onion, diced
- Prepare 2 ripe medium sized tomatoes (if small sized use three), diced
- Make ready Oil for frying
- Make ready to taste Salt
- Take Garlic leaves (optional)
- Make ready Chives for garnish

Steps to make Ndizi ya kisii (banana stew):
- Take your banana, peel, slice,wash and set aside. Also prepare the other ingredients
- On medium heat, heat your skillet /pot. Add oil and heat till hot enough then add the onions and garlic leaves. Fry and cook till tender and translucent
- Add the tomatoes, mix, cover your pot and cook till tender
- Now add your sliced banana. Sprinkle some salt to taste then mix everything up till well incorporated.
- Add water to the banana till its on the same level as the bananas as shown below. Cover and bring to boil. Once the water boils reduce the heat to medium low and let your banana simmer till the water almost dries up but not completely, after around 20-25 minutes. Careful not to burn the banana.
- Once cooked, garnish with parsley or chives. Serve with chicken/beef/mutton stew and a cup of tea. Enjoy π π€€
